Newest Additions to the Trinity Athletic Staff!!

Trinity’s athletic coaching staff has evolved over this past summer. With the hiring of a new head women’s basketball coach Tiffany Lockett, new assistant soccer coach, Najla Muhammad and two new assistant volleyball coaches, Brianna Clark and Khalid Kiker. Also, former assistant soccer coach, Jason Gross has been promoted to women’s head soccer coach.

Jason Gross will serve as the women’s head soccer coach after two years as the assistant coach at Trinity. Gross played Division 1 soccer at Howard University and went on to play professionally after being selected by the NJ Ironman of the Major Indoor Soccer League. He has coached for more than a decade in youth travel and high school soccer. Gross currently serves as the Director of Coaching for ACG Academy and recently earned a Master’s in Education from American University.

As for our new assistant soccer coach, Najla Muhammad, she comes with plenty of experience as a head coach with Capital Futbol Club in Washington, DC; head coach at Bishop McNamara High School, District Heights, MD; a youth soccer coach and trainer with Upper Marlboro Boys and Girls Club in MD and a youth coach/counselor at La Salle University’s community center.

“I’m very excited to step into the assistant coach role at Trinity, especially under a talented head coach such as Jason. The learning opportunities will be endless, and I believe together we have the potential to make a huge impact within the program,” said Muhammad.

Muhammad played Division 3 soccer at La Salle University where she earned a Bachelors in Criminal Justice and MBA.

To assistant volleyball head coach Shinicka Spears this season we will have both Kiker Khalid and Brianna Clark.

Khalid holds a BA in Economics, MS in Accounting and Management as well as a Graduate Certificate in Sports Management, specialization volleyball. Khalid played professional volleyball overseas for 19 years including the Moroccan National Team from 1986-1990 and 1994-1999. Following his professional playing experience Khalid worked youth counselor and volleyball coach in CA; HS girls volleyball coach in OK and Assistant Coach for women’s volleyball at Marymount University in VA from 2005-2007.

Filling our second assistant volleyball coaching positions is Brianna Clark, who comes with playing experience at the Division 2 level playing for Virginia State University as a defensive specialist/libero from 2009-2012. At VSU she was a four letter winner where she earned Student-Scholar Honors all 4 years, served as the Vice-President of SAAC and earned her BS in family and consumer sciences. Following she earned a masters in Counseling from Old Dominion University in 2014. Clark is currently a second year doctoral student in the Higher Education Leadership and Policy Studies program at Howard University.

“I am honored and thankful to be a part of this growing program and the Trinity family. Volleyball has been a part of my life for 11 years and I’m excited to grow within the game even more. Coaching is a special calling, one in which I don’t take lightly and my goal is to assist in developing young women on and off the court. It’s going to be a great season! Go Tigers,” said Clark.

The Trinity community is excited about all the changes within the program and believes it will lead the program and student-athletes to success on and off the court/field in the years to come.
